Overview of Alum Creek Demographics

The population of Alum Creek is 1,637, with a population density of 161 people per square mile, diverging from the national average of 91. The median age is 46.9 and 81% of individuals aged 15 or older are married, while 27% have children under 18. As far as income equality in Alum Creek goes, 2% of households have a median income below $25,000, whereas 7% report an income exceeding $150,000. Alum Creek Racial Demographics & Ethnicity

Recognizing the racial demographics and ethnicity breakdown of Alum Creek is pivotal for addressing systemic inequities, championing social justice and inclusion and fostering resilient communities. In Alum Creek, the racial breakdown comprises 98.6% White, 0% Black or African American, 0% Asian, 0% American Indian, and 0% Native Hawaiian, with 0% of the population identifying as Hispanic or Latino. 100% of households reported speaking English only, while 0% reported speaking Spanish only. Furthermore, 0% of residents were categorized as foreign-born.

      Race Alum Creek West Virginia National
      White 98.61% 93.46% 73.35%
      Black 0.00% 3.43% 12.63%
      Asian 0.00% 0.76% 5.22%
      American Indian 0.00% 0.18% 0.82%
      Native Hawaiian 0.00% 0.04% 0.18%
      Mixed race 1.39% 1.83% 3.06%
      Other race 0.00% 0.31% 4.75%
      In Alum Creek, 0.0% of people are of Hispanic or Latino origin.
      Please note: Hispanics may be of any race, so also are included in any/all of the applicable race categories above.
